Top Features
  • SDS-max: Tool-free bit changes with automatic bit locking, dust protection and maximum impact energy transfer rate
  • Best in class Impact Energy: Impact energy of 12.1 ft lbs provides maximum productivity in all day demolition applications
  • Vario-lock: Rotates and locks chisel into 12 different positions to optimize working angles
  • Selector knob: Select between hammer drilling, chiseling only and the Vario-Lock function. Impact Energy/EPTA (ft. lbs.): 9.3 ft. / lbs. EPTA
  • Variable Speed Dial: for controlled drilling and demolition applications. Amperage 13.5
  • Improved performance
  • Makita-built 4-pole motor delivers 750 in.Lbs. Of max torque, 25% more than the previous model
  • Mechanical 2-speed transmission (0-400 & 0-2, 000 RPM) for a wide range of drilling and fastening applications
  • Extreme protection technology (XPT) engineered for improved dust and water resistance for operation in harsh job site conditions
  • All metal gears and aluminum gear housing for maximum job site durability

Like Butter!
Rating: 5
This drill makes holes in concrete like butter ( just make sure you hold it straight, and don't hit any re-bar!). I put 15 holes through 8 inches of concrete in a matter of minutes, just make sure you tighten the auxiliary handle well or the tool will spin on you! Comes with a large case that holes extra drills, and a really long cord (~ 10 ft.). The variable speed is handy as well as the hammer only mode ( I would also like a drill only mode as well a a reversing switch). Fine tool although the cardboard shipping box could be more robust and some foam inside the case to keep the tool from sliding around during transport.
